Henry W. ‘Buster’ Kraner, 60, of Berger Street, New Castle, died Sunday, January 17, 2016 at his home in New Castle. He was born October 30, 1955 in New Castle, the son of the late Henry Kraner and Barbara (Morrow) Kraner, his mother survives in New Castle. Mr. Kraner worked as a welder for Pullman Standard and Trinity Steel and then was a conductor for CSX. He enjoyed hunting, fishing, gardening, and cooking. He also loved listening to Rock and Roll and was an avid Steelers fan.
In addition to his mother he is survived by one daughter, Stephaine R. Kraner of Pittsburgh, his companion, Lisa Norse of New Castle, six sisters, Ann Marie Grimm and her husband William of Cortland, OH, Kathy Hudak and her husband John of Mercer Co., PA, Barbara Jean Kraner of New Castle, Faith Elaine Kraner of New Castle, Audrey Merck and her husband Christopher of Midland, PA, and Kimberly Bleakney and her husband Everett of Lisbon, OH, thirteen nieces and nephews, fifteen great nieces and nephews and three great great nieces and nephews.
Visitation will be held at the William F. & Roger M. DeCarbo Funeral Home, 926 Cunningham Avenue on Friday, January 22, 2016 from 4 PM to 6 PM.
Funeral services will be held Friday, January 22, 2016 at 6:00 P.M. at the William F. DeCarbo Memorial Chapel. Rev. Jarod Mills of Clifton Flats Alliance Church will be officiating.
